The AV Programmer will be responsible for programming and configuring audiovisual systems for a variety of installations and events. This includes programming control systems, troubleshooting technical issues, and ensuring smooth operation of AV systems. The ideal candidate should have a strong understanding of AV hardware, software, and control systems, with a keen attention to detail and problem-solving skills.
Program, configure, and integrate AV control systems (Crestron, AMX, Extron, QSYS, Kramer, etc.) for new installations and system upgrades.
Develop and customize user interfaces for clients, ensuring ease of use and functionality.
Collaborate with engineers, designers, and project managers to deliver solutions that meet client needs.
Troubleshoot AV system issues on-site, providing timely resolutions to minimize downtime.
Conduct system tests and ensure systems are fully functional before handover.
Provide training to end-users on system operation and maintenance.
Stay up-to-date with the latest AV technology trends and advancements.
Document system designs, programming code, and project changes.
Offer post-installation support and perform system maintenance as needed.
Proven experience as an AV Programmer or similar role in AV integration or installation.
Strong proficiency in programming AV control systems (Crestron, AMX, Extron, QSYS, Kramer etc.).
Knowledge of audio, video, and networking technologies, including IP-based control and automation.
Experience with multimedia systems, video conferencing setups, and digital signage.
